Context

LBHF is a dormant ASN registrant for AS210988, visible only in internet number registries. No routing activity, website, or verified organization exists. The entity poses minimal current risk but warrants monitoring because dormant ASNs can later activate. Evidence is limited to three official sources; full identity, ownership, and purpose remain unconfirmed.
